#34cbce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#34cbce is composed of 20.4% red, 79.6%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.8% cyan, 1.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 181.2 degrees, a saturation of 61.1% and a lightness of 50.6%. #34cbce color hex could be obtained by blending #68ffff with #00979d.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#34cbce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f2fc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#34cbce

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#788a8a is the less saturated color, while #04fafe is the most saturated one.
